Driving licence must for riding electric scooters in Dubai

Dubai has issued new regulations for the use of bicycles, electric bikes and scooters and has specified 21 violations that can attract fines of up to Dh300 and confiscation of the bikes.
 
The regulations, which also cover permit requirements, safety guidelines, technical requirements and age limits, are governed by the Executive Council Resolution No (13) of 2022 issued by Sheikh Hamdan bin Mohammed bin Rashid Al Maktoum, Crown Prince of Dubai and Chairman of the Executive Council of Dubai.
 
A driving license is now essential to ride electric scooters. Riders below 16 years are not permitted to ride an electric bike or electric scooter or any other type of bike specified by the Roads and Transport Authority (RTA).
 
Cyclists below 12 years should be accompanied by an adult cyclist who is 18 years or older and pillion riding has been banned when there is no extra seat for a pillion rider.
 
Riding bikes or bicycles without receiving RTA’s approval, either for group training (more than four cyclists/bikers), or individual training (less than four), is strictly prohibited. Riders should always make sure they do not obstruct movement on cycling tracks.
